    摘要: A plasma display panel capable of improving a black area ratio and a bright room contrast and reducing a reflected luminance by coloring different layers in the plasma display panel is provided. The plasma display panel includes: a rear substrate; a front substrate colored with a first chromatic color and facing the rear substrate; barrier ribs disposed between the front and rear substrates and defining discharge cells; address electrodes extending in a first direction on the rear substrate and corresponding to the discharge cells; phosphor layers disposed in the discharge cells, wherein at least one of the phosphor layers is colored with a second chromatic color; display electrodes extending in a second direction crossing the first direction on the front substrate and corresponding to the discharge cells; and a front dielectric layer disposed on the front substrate to cover the display electrodes and colored with a third chromatic color.

    摘要: A plasma display panel includes first and second substrates facing and spaced apart from each other, barrier ribs disposed between the first and second substrates to define discharge cells, address electrodes formed on the first substrate and extending in a first direction to correspond to the discharge cells, first and second electrodes formed on the second substrate and extending in a second direction crossing the first direction to correspond to the discharge cells, and a dielectric layer formed on the second substrate to cover the first and second electrodes. The first and second electrodes each include a plurality of bus lines of which some of the bus lines form discharge gaps at a central portion of the respective discharge cells. The dielectric layer is provided with grooves formed within the discharge gaps to decrease the requisite firing voltage and improve the light emission efficiency of the panel.

    摘要: A plasma display panel (PDP) includes: a front substrate; a rear substrate disposed in opposition to the front substrate; first barrier ribs disposed between the front substrate and the rear substrate, defining discharge cells with the front substrate and the rear substrate, and formed of a dielectric material; front discharge electrodes disposed inside the first barrier ribs so as to surround the discharge cells; rear discharge electrodes disposed inside the first barrier ribs so as to surround the discharge cells, and spaced apart from the front discharge electrodes; phosphor layers disposed in the discharge cells; and a discharge gas deposited in the discharge cells. With respect to a longitudinal sectional view of the first barrier ribs, a virtual horizontal axis which extends from a lowermost portion of each of the rear discharge electrodes and is parallel to the front substrate intersects a lateral surface of the first barrier ribs at a certain position. An angle between a tangent line at the intersection of the horizontal axis and a lateral surface of the first barrier ribs, on one hand, and a virtual vertical axis orthogonal to the horizontal axis, on the other hand, ranges from 4° to 17°.
